Spend the extra coin and get a used 2019 or 2020 because of the oil pump issue. So far my 2017 has been good to go at over 16,000 miles but I definitely am keeping an eye on it. Do a search on Cars.com 250 miles from your zip code and I bet you will find a few for sale. Just depends on what options and colors you are looking for and of course pricing too.
